How to fill out the Oklahoma State Tax Forms online

This guide will assist you in completing the Oklahoma State Tax Forms online with ease and clarity. By following this step-by-step guide, you will understand each section and what information is vital for successful submission.

Follow the steps to fill out your Oklahoma State Tax Forms online.

  1. Click the 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the Oklahoma State Tax Form and open it in your document editor.
  2. Start by entering your personal information at the top of the form. This includes your social security number, name, and address. If filing jointly, provide your partner's information as well.
  3. Proceed to the exemptions section. Indicate the total number of exemptions you are claiming, including dependents. Each exemption should be accounted for accurately.
  4. Fill in your Federal Adjusted Gross Income as reported on your federal tax return. Ensure this amount matches your federal filing.
  5. Provide any subtractions from your income as specified. This can include state and municipal bond interest and other specific deductions. Make sure to reference the instructions for line details.
  6. Enter your deductions in the next section. You can choose either standardized deductions or itemized deductions, depending on what you claimed on your federal return.
  7. Calculate your Oklahoma Adjusted Gross Income by subtracting the total deductions from your Federal AGI.
  8. Determine your taxable income by adjusting for any special considerations like military exclusions or disability deductions.
  9. Access the Oklahoma tax tables to find applicable tax amounts based on your taxable income. Enter this figure on the form.
  10. Review your entries for accuracy before submitting the form. After filling out all sections, you can save changes, download, print, or share the completed form as needed.

The minimum income required to file Oklahoma State Tax Forms depends on your filing status and age, with thresholds updated annually. Generally, single filers under 65 must file if they earn more than $12,400. Make sure to check the latest information from the Oklahoma Tax Commission to stay compliant with state laws. Understanding these limits ensures you can meet your tax obligations.

You should send your completed Oklahoma State Tax Forms to the address specified in the instructions accompanying the forms. Generally, for most filers, the address is the Oklahoma Tax Commission in Oklahoma City. Always verify the correct address on the official site, as it can change based on your filing method and residency status. This ensures your return reaches the appropriate department without delay.

Failing to file Oklahoma State Tax Forms can result in penalties and interest accruing on any unpaid taxes. The state may take action to collect the owed amounts, including wage garnishments and bank levies. Additionally, you may lose out on potential refunds or credits, which could benefit your financial situation. Timely filing helps you avoid these complications.

The deadline to file Oklahoma State Tax Forms typically aligns with the federal deadline, which is usually April 15. This date can vary slightly if it falls on a weekend or holiday. It is important to keep track of any updates from the Oklahoma Tax Commission to stay compliant. Missing this deadline can lead to penalties and interest on any owed taxes.

Oklahoma tax form 511 is the state's individual income tax return form designed for residents. It is used by individuals to report their income, claim deductions, and calculate taxes owed or refunds due. By filing form 511, you ensure compliance with Oklahoma tax laws while accurately reporting your income.
